Aluminium Windows
As a modern material, aluminium offers homeowners in St Albans the chance to improve their home's thermal efficiency. Since it's a material that is lightweight, it's capable of helping to seal up areas where cool or heated air can escape. This means that homes with aluminium windows will be able to cut their energy costs and also enjoy lower energy bills.
Aluminum is also extremely durable. It is an excellent choice for those who wish to upgrade their doors and windows with a strong material that will last decades. Unlike other window materials that are susceptible to warping, cracking or discolour over time, aluminium is resistant to rust and won't need repainting or refinishing. This is all thanks to the top-quality powder coatings that are applied to each individual aluminium profile.

Aluminium Bifold Doors
Nothing connects your home to your garden more than an aluminum bifold door. This allows you to bring your most loved areas of the outside in and create a seamless transition between your living space and your outdoor space. Our bespoke bifold door can be tailored to your home and can be made to order. They are available in a range of finishes, colours and opening configurations.
Our custom bifolding doors in St Albans have been designed to consider the changing climate of the UK. They are able to hold and preserve heat while repelling colder, drier air. This gives homeowners in St Albans a more comfortable and peaceful home all through the all seasons. By reducing heating costs they can also lower their energy bills.
In contrast to traditional UPVC bifold doors Our doors fold back against the wall in a concertina-style when they are open and allow you to maximize your living space. They are perfect for St Albans residents who want to increase the amount of light in their home and give it a modern appearance.
Aluminium bifold doors can be equipped with the most advanced locking systems available to ensure that your home is safe and secure. They include locking systems with 8 points that are anti-snap and anti-drill as well as bolts that are chamfered. They are able to resist the most ruthless of intruders. They are also extremely resistant to weather conditions, meaning they will not rust, warp or fade. It is also easy to clean them using warm soapy water and a quick wipe. This helps to keep them looking nice for longer, and also ensures that they are performing in the way they were intended to.

Composite Front Doors
In contrast to traditional timber doors or standard uPVC windows, composite front doors provide the latest technology in a design that is built to last. They're available in a wide range of colours, finishes and glazing options to suit any home.
These high-performance, low-maintenance doors feature a solid core that can help reduce energy costs. They are also resistant to warping and fade when exposed to sunlight. This makes them an excellent alternative to traditional wooden door.
Composite doors are made of solid fibreglass shells with aluminium and steel reinforcing, and insulated with foam to keep homes warm and energy efficient. They are available in a range of designs and styles, including wood effect finishes, to suit any property. They're also robust and have a long life typically lasting 30 years or more with no need for maintenance.

Conservatories
A conservatory is a great way to add additional living space to your St Albans property. It can not only add an additional living space, but also increase the value and lifespan of your Hertfordshire property. You can use it for the dining area or a playroom for your kids, or as a space to relax.
There are a variety of styles of conservatories on the market, and it's crucial to know which will suit your home the best. It is recommended that if are unsure of which style to pick, you visit a conservatory show room before making a choice. There, you'll be able see different designs and get an understanding of how they can fit into your Hertfordshire home.
Lean-to Conservatories are popular among homeowners due to their minimalistic and elegant design that can compliment any style of home. This type of conservatory has the highest glass coverage, allowing it to flood your Hertfordshire home with light and provide stunning views of the outdoors all year round.
